In Governance as Leadership:  Reframing the Work of Boards, Chait and his colleagues identify the three modes of governance that lead to high performing boards.  We are remiss, however, in thinking that the three modes of  performance—fiduciary, strategic and generative—that  Chait et. al. identify as essential for high performance should be reserved for improving board performance. Each is equally important for improving organizational and programmatic performance. Thus, we must not limit these three modes to our boards, but be just as intentional in using them Read more
